The Role and Training of Psychiatry Experts

Psychiatry experts are medical doctors who have completed substantial specialized training beyond general medical education. After making their medical degrees, these experts complete a four-year residency program focused solely on psychological health, acquiring hands-on experience in various settings including health centers, outpatient clinics, and community health centers. This extensive preparation equips them with the special ability to understand the detailed relationship between physical health, mental health, and brain function.

What distinguishes psychiatry professionals from other psychological health professionals is their medical training, which enables them to recommend medication and comprehend the physiological foundations of mental conditions. They approach patient care holistically, considering how biological, mental, and social factors engage to affect mental health. This biopsychosocial design allows psychiatry professionals to establish comprehensive treatment plans that may integrate medication management with psychotherapy, lifestyle modifications, and coordination with other health care service providers.

How Psychiatry Experts Differ from Other Mental Health Professionals

The psychological health field consists of various experts, and understanding the differences in between them assists people make informed decisions about their care. Psychologists, for example, hold postgraduate degrees in psychology and specialize in psychotherapy and https://private-mental-health-assessmentmisb935.bearsfanteamshop.com/10-meetups-on-private-mental-health-assessment-cost-uk-you-should-attend mental screening, however they can not prescribe medication in a lot of states. Accredited scientific social employees and certified professional counselors offer important healing services and crisis intervention, yet they do not have the medical training that characterizes psychiatry professionals.

Psychiatry experts inhabit a distinct position since they can prescribe medication, which is typically important for handling numerous psychiatric conditions efficiently. They also bring medical training that allows them to dismiss underlying physical conditions that may manifest as psychiatric signs, such as thyroid dysfunction causing depression or neurological conditions providing with anxiety. This medical background shows important when treating clients with complex conditions needing both medication management and healing intervention.

What to Expect During a Psychiatric Consultation

When individuals set up an appointment with a psychiatry expert, the preliminary examination typically lasts between sixty and ninety minutes. Throughout this detailed assessment, the psychiatry professional evaluates the patient's medical and psychiatric history, checks out household history of psychological health conditions, and talks about present signs in detail. The professional may likewise administer standardized assessment tools to assist quantify sign intensity and develop baseline measurements for tracking treatment progress.

Following this assessment, the psychiatry specialist establishes a tailored treatment strategy tailored to the person's specific requirements and situations. This plan might consist of prescription medication, suggestions for psychiatric therapy, lifestyle adjustments, and strategies for managing ecological triggers or stress factors. Psychiatry experts generally set up follow-up visits to keep an eye on medication effectiveness, adjust does as needed, and examine progress towards treatment objectives. Numerous patients discover that the relationship with their psychiatry specialist ends up being a continuous collaboration in keeping psychological health.

Often Asked Questions About Psychiatry Experts

When should someone see a psychiatry specialist instead of a therapist?

Individuals need to think about consulting a psychiatry professional when signs significantly impair everyday operating, continue for more than 2 weeks, or involve thoughts of self-harm. Psychiatry experts are especially suitable when medication might be needed, when physical health conditions may be contributing to psychiatric signs, or when previous therapy alone has actually not supplied adequate relief. Lots of clients advantage from combined care, seeing both a therapist for psychotherapy and a psychiatry expert for medication management.

Do psychiatry experts only prescribe medication?

While medication management is a substantial element of psychiatric practice, psychiatry experts likewise offer psychiatric therapy, conduct diagnostic evaluations, and coordinate extensive treatment plans. Lots of psychiatry experts preserve active treatment practices, especially those with additional training in particular healing modalities. The best psychiatric care often combines multiple techniques customized to specific patient needs.

For how long does psychiatric treatment usually last?

Treatment duration differs significantly based on the condition being treated, its severity, and how the client reacts to intervention. Some clients require just short-term treatment for situational problems, while others gain from continuous maintenance treatment for chronic conditions. Psychiatry professionals work with clients to establish treatment objectives and routinely reassess whether ongoing care remains needed, empowering patients to make informed choices about their psychological health journey.

Are visits to psychiatry specialists confidential?

Absolutely. Like all doctor, psychiatry professionals are bound by rigorous confidentiality guidelines, with information secured under physician-patient advantage. Exceptions exist just in specific scenarios, such as when a patient positions impending risk to themselves or others, when child abuse is thought, or when court purchased. Psychiatry specialists talk about privacy criteria with clients during preliminary appointments to establish trust and guarantee notified consent.
